How To Measure Your Sex Doll?

One of the biggest challenges when buying clothes for your sex doll is getting the right size.

Unlike real humans, it’s not very practical to take your doll shopping with you, and even if you get past that, you will most certainly be met with dirty looks from people that don’t know how to mind their business.

However, on the other hand, getting the wrong size and essentially throwing money down the drain on something that won’t look nice at all isn’t an option, either.

So the only reasonable thing to do before getting that dress you really like is measuring your sex doll’s proportions.

This may sound like a pain in the neck to do, but it’s actually very simple. Below, you will find detailed explanations on how to correctly measure each body area.

Once you’re done, you should then write down your measurements and look up the sizes that match your measurements the closest. This will tell you which size you should look for when purchasing clothes for your sex doll.

Bust

This measurement is used for tops and dresses.

To measure, place one end of the tape measure at the fullest part of your doll’s bust and wrap it around her body to get the measurement, keeping the tape parallel to the floor.

Bra Sizing

Finding the right bra for your sex doll can be a little complicated if you haven’t manually-selected her breast-size while customizing her.

However, if you have already decided that you want to buy a bra for your doll, it is important to get the right one. If a bra is too tight, it can potentially leave lines on the skin and a loose one just won’t look nice at all.

Bras are sized using a unique system based on two measurements of the bust area:

To find your doll’s band size, use a tape measurer to measure around her ribs right under her breasts. This is the area where the band of the bra will wrap around her torso. Pull the tape tight and write down this measurement.

If your doll’s measurement is a fraction (like 33 1/2 inches), round up to the nearest whole number (34 inches).

Band sizes are measured in even numbers, so if your doll’s measurement was odd, you may want to try one size up and one size down (if you measure 35 inches, try both the 34 and the 36 size bra).

To find your doll’s bust size, wrap the measuring tape around her back and measure her breasts at their fullest point, usually at the nipple. Write down this measurement.

Next, you want to subtract the band size from the bust size.

The difference between these two numbers is your key to finding your doll’s cup size.

  • 1-inch difference = A cup.
  • 2 inches = B cup.
  • 3 inches = C cup.
  • 4 inches = D cup.
  • 5 inches = DD cup.

Once you go above 5 inches (12.7 cm), cup sizes will differ with each company. There should be a sizing chart on the company’s website and you can use your band and bust measurement to find which cup you want.

Next, you wanna combine the cup size with your band measurement, and you have your final bra size. A 34C means, your doll has a 34-inch band with a C cup.

Waist

This measurement is used mainly for jeans, pants, skirts, and sometimes dresses.

Most clothing lines use the measurement of the “natural waist” for their size guides. To measure your doll’s natural waist, you want to find the narrowest part of her waist, located above her belly button and below her rib cage.

Hips

This measurement is used for bottoms. The hip should be measured around its fullest part (about 8 inches below your doll’s waist).

Inseam

This measurement is used for trousers and jeans. The inseam is the measurement from the ankle to the groin when standing with the legs straight.
To make this measure you should either hang your doll straight (if possible) or lay her down on a flat surface.

Which Fabrics Can Stain Your Sex Doll?

This is a very important thing to know before venturing into the world of sex doll fashion as there are fabrics that can potentially stain your doll’s skin and this can be incredibly difficult if not impossible to remove without making further damage.

Both TPE and silicone are materials that can be easily stained under certain circumstances. One such example is leaving your sex doll exposed to excessive heat while wearing certain clothing.

So, here are a few materials you want to avoid when purchasing new clothes for your sex doll:

  • Latex
  • Faux and real leather
  • Jeans/Denim
  • Wool (it won’t stain the skin but it will shed all over your sex doll and the lints are incredibly difficult to remove)

Additionally, besides avoiding certain fabrics, you may also want to pay attention to avoid as much as possible certain colors as these may also bleed onto your doll’s skin and stain her.

When buying doll clothes, be careful not to buy clothes that have strong pigment colors such as red, purple, magenta, plum, wine, black, dark blue, navy, etc.

If you really like a dark piece and want to see your doll wearing dark clothing, make sure to at least take a few necessary precautions to ensure her skin won’t get stained.

The first thing to do is to either wash the dark clothes a few times just to make sure that they won’t bleed and transfer color or leave them to soak in cold water overnight. Repeat this process until the water where the clothes have soaked is completely clear.

The second thing to do is to create a barrier between your doll’s skin and dark clothes.

You can do this by wrapping up the areas where the fabric touches the skin with several layers of stretch and seal which will prevent color from transferring directly onto the skin.

Which Fabrics Are Sex-Doll Safe?

Additionally, there are fabrics that are super-safe for your sex doll and you will most probably never encounter any staining or any other unpleasant surprise when taking them off.

Here are some of the safest sex doll fabrics:

  • Cotton
  • Silk
  • Spandex
  • Lycra
  • Velvet
  • Lace
  • Nylon

Furthermore, the ideal colors that are safe for both TPE and silicone are gentle pastel colors, beige, white, cream, baby pinks and blues, lilac, lavender, green, etc.

Where To Buy Clothes For Your Sex Doll?

When buying clothes for your sex doll for the first time ever, it is best to opt for second-hand or thrift stores.

These clothes are usually very affordable and because someone has worn them before, they have been washed multiple times, meaning they are less likely to bleed and damage your doll’s skin.

Buying clothes from second-hand or thrift stores is also useful when you are learning your doll’s size and figuring out what looks good on her and what doesn’t.

Additionally, these stores usually accept returns for up to 30 days which is more than enough time for you to figure out whether you like the item or not. One of the most reliable thrift stores for women’s clothing is Swap.
